Bináris számrendszer (kettes számrendszer):
Jellemzői:
- 2db számjegy van
- Legkisebb szám a 0, legnagyobb az 1
- Számrendszer alapszáma 2
- Helyi értékes számrendszer
A kettes számrendszer a számítógépek működésének az alapja. A kettes számrendszer jelentősége az elektronikus digitális számítógépek elterjedésével megnőtt, mert az adatokat 2-es számrendszerben célszerű ábrázolni. A számítógép be-kikapcsolók összessége, amely csak két szám használatával valósítható meg. A bináris információk előállítását tranzisztorok végzik. Ha az áram átfolyik rajtuk, akkor 1-es, ha nem, akkor 0 jelet állít elő, melyet BIT-nek hívunk.
Átvitt értelemben binárisnak nevezünk minden olyan rendszert vagy szerkezetet, amelynek működési elve kétállapotú elemeken alapszik Az első számítógépek 16 bitesek voltak, mellyel max. 65536 számot tudunk megjeleníteni. A mai PC-k 32 bitesek, mellyel 4294967296 számot képesek használni. A tranzisztorok alkalmasak a számok rögzítésére, azokkal való műveletek végzésére, valamint az adott bit igaz vagy hamis voltának eldöntésére, lehetővé téve ezzel az algebra alkalmazását. A tranzisztorok különböző kombinációinak alakzatait LOGIKAI-KAPUKNAK nevezzük, amelyek fél összeadóknak nevezett tömbökbe, azok pedig teljes összeadókban vannak egyesítve.
A bináris szám is felírható a tízes számrendszerbeli értékével. Ennek módja: az egyes helyi értékeket elfoglaló bináris számjegyeket megszorozzuk a 2-nek a helyi érték szerinti hatványával, majd a kapott értékeket összeadjuk. Jelölése: 100112 vagy 10011B vagy %10011. Tízes számrendszerben ez a következőképpen írható fel: 1*24+0*23+0*22+1*21+1*20=19 [10]
Törtszámoknál is hasonlóképpen járhatunk el pl: 0,1011 esetén: 1*2-1+0*2-2+1*2-3+1*2-4 = 1/2+0+1/8+1/16 = 0,6875 [10]
Műveletek kettes számrendszerben
Összeadás: Bitenként adjuk össze a számokat az előző átvitelek figyelembe vételével. Az egyes bitösszegeket az összeadó bitek kizáró vagy kapcsolata adja meg
0+0=0 0+1=1 1+0=1 1+1=0 → átvitel 1 (10)
Kivonás: A kivonás az összeadásra vezethető vissza az A-B= A+(-B) összefüggés alapján. Azaz a kisebbítendőhöz a kivonandó ellentettjét. Kettes számrendszerben egy szám ellentettjét kettes komplemensnek nevezzük.
A kettes komplemens előállításának két módszere:
- Képezzük a szám egyes komplemensét, ezt úgy tesszük, hogy a számot bitenként invertáljuk. Majd az így kapott egyes komplemenshez hozzáadunk 1-et. Így kapjuk a kettes komplemenst számolással.
- jobbról az első 1-ig leírjuk változatlanul a biteket, az első 1-et is, majd innen kezdve invertáljuk a biteket.
0-0=0 1-1=0 1-0=1 0-1=10-1=1
Szorzás: Bitenként összeszorozzuk a számokat, majd az összeadásra vonatkozó szabályokkal összeadjuk az egyes részszorzatokat.
Osztás: Az osztás kettes számrendszerben úgy történik, mint a tízesben. Az osztandó számot szorzatként vizsgáljuk. Ha pl:kétjegyű számmal osztunk, akkor az osztandó szám első két számjegyét vizsgáljuk. Ha osztható vele, akkor az eredményhez leírunk egy 1-est. Majd az osztandó szám alá visszaszorozzuk és kivonjuk egymásból. Majd beszorozzuk a következő számjegyet és folytatjuk tovább az osztást, míg a maradék nulla nem lesz a végén.
|